Cost of Living Comparison Between Phuket and Yichang Cost of Living Comparison Between Phuket and Yichang

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,250 in Phuket versus $713 in Yichang.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,284 in Phuket versus $1,145 in Yichang.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,317 in Phuket versus $1,577 in Yichang.

Living in Phuket is roughly 75% more expensive than in Yichang,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ities sit below the global median: Phuket 6% lower, Yichang 47%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$626 in Phuket and $281 in Yichang.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Dining out: $46.00 in Phuket vs $22.00 in Yichang for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$289 vs $198 per month, with Yichang cheaper across the board.

Phuket vs Yichang: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Is Yichang cheaper than Phuket?
Yichang is cheaper overall, especially in Groceries & Markets, Clothing & Footwear, Eating Out, Sport & Entertainment, Monthly Utilities & Internet. The 75% gap adds up to real monthly savings that compound significantly over time.
What income do you need for each city?
You'd need roughly $1,875 in Phuket and $1,070 in Yichang to live well. The gap comes down to housing and overall price levels. Both cities are liveable on less, but these numbers represent actual comfort.
What is the rent difference between Phuket and Yichang?
Rent for a central apartment: $626 in Phuket versus $281 in Yichang.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
Which city has cheaper kindergarten?
Childcare runs $706 in Phuket versus $335 in Yichang.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
How do food prices compare in Phuket and in Yichang?
Supermarket bills run roughly 46% higher in Phuket. For households that cook at home regularly, that difference adds up over a month.
